Coffee grounds are an excellent addition to the soil of your garden. They can provide a rich source of nutrient and improve the soil's texture. They also help to stop the growth of weeds and increase moisture in the soil. It's important to understand the proper amount to add. Too much can hinder root development and reduce the health of the plant.

Another benefit of coffee grounds is that they can be utilized as an organic fertilizer. They contain nitrogen as well as phosphorous and potassium (NPK), which are all essential nutrients for plant growth. These nutrients are often missing in backyard gardens and their addition can boost the health and vitality of your plants. NPK is a powerful and safe alternative to chemical fertilizers.
